Venezuela’s Move to Crypto and away from State Sanctions and Inflation
In order to curb inflation in Venezuela, five zeroes will be removed from the national currency, the Bolivar according to July 26, 2018, reports. Furthermore, the value of the money will reportedly be tied to the government-controlled cryptocurrency, the Petro. дальше »

Cryptocurrency Miners Face the Heat as Vietnam Bans Imports and Taiwanese Chipmaker Lowers Revenue Figures
The State Bank of Vietnam (SBV), the East Asian country’s central bank, announced on July 19, 2018, the import of cryptocurrency miners to the nation is indefinitely suspended. New York Looks to Attract Cryptocurrency Miners With New Electricity Tariffs
The state of New York has approved a new set of utility rates aimed at attracting further investment from crypto miners into the state. Under the new framework, crypto miners who have descended on upstate New York to take advantage of low electricity prices will now be able to negotiate contracts with a utility supplier. дальше »
